Exploring the Bible TogetherZoom Bible Study every Tuesday from 6:30pm -7:30pm In our “Exploring the Bible Together” study, we meet by Zoom as a small group for about 45 minutes each week. Our study covers a wide range of topics, examining more closely the history, content, context, development, message, and interpretation of the Bible. As we do this, we grow in our understanding of the relevance and application of the Bible for our lives today. Summer Bible Study on The Apostle Paul: We invite you to journey with us this summer as we follow the Apostle Paul, learning about how the early church was planted and grew from a small sect within Judaism in the 1st century to our beloved faith practiced by billions of people through today. In May, we began a 16 week study of the Apostle Paul - the person, the missionary and the letter writer - based on the book, The Greatest Story: Paul (Augsburg Fortress), This study does not require you to purchase the book, but it is helpful. Three Expressions of the Church
We are part of one church body organized in three expressions — congregations, synods, and the churchwide organization. Each expression has its particular functions but all three together share a common mission of doing God’s work in the world and proclaiming the good news of Jesus Christ. Together, they ensure a solid foundation of leadership, active involvement in communities, opportunities for dialogue and diverse perspectives, creative partnerships, and support for members and ministries of the ELCA.
